true dual exhaust question

I have a friend that is going to remove the stock system with the 1 in 2 out flowmaster and custom make a true dual system with two flowmasters. I'm asking how will it sound with the mufflers closer to the engine or by the gas tank location like the stock set-up is. He says with the dual mufflers it will be louder but my main concern is how it sounds. My friend's has a 88 monte SS with the flowmaster by the tranny area and I like the way that sounded. Also i'm worried about if the mufflers were by the tranny area would I have problems it hitting speed bumps?

there are countless threads on this, do a search. The closer you put the mufflers to the engine the louder it will be. I had mine under the front seats for a while, and its just ridicolusly(sp?) loud, not to mention dragging on every bump in the street. You can put them under your rear seats for best fitment and ground clearance. I beat my rear seats up and got alot more gound clearence. My car was a V6 car so i didn't care about beating the bottom of the car up. I wouldn't do that to my other one though.

Got the problem fixed!

Well anyways then relocated the mufflers below the rear seat becasue the raspy sound was from the lenght of the tail pipes, it has to be no shorter than 3 feet is what they reccomend. So now it has that nice duel sound to it...
